C# 클래스 Apache.Shiro.Authc.SimpleAccount

상속: IAccount, IMergeableAuthenticationInfo
파일 보기 프로젝트 열기: katasource/shironet

공개 메소드들

메소드 설명
AddObjectPermission ( IPermission permission ) : void
AddObjectPermissions ( IEnumerable e ) : void
AddRole ( string role ) : void
AddRoles ( IEnumerable roles ) : void
AddStringPermission ( string permission ) : void
AddStringPermissions ( IEnumerable e ) : void
Equals ( object obj ) : bool
GetHashCode ( ) : int
Merge ( IAuthenticationInfo other ) : void
SimpleAccount ( ) : System
SimpleAccount ( ICollection principals, object credentials, string realmName, ISet roles = null, ISet permissions = null ) : System
SimpleAccount ( IPrincipalCollection principals, object credentials, ISet roles = null, ISet permissions = null ) : System
SimpleAccount ( object principal, object credentials, string realmName, ISet roles = null, ISet permissions = null ) : System
ToString ( ) : string

메소드 상세

AddObjectPermission() 공개 메소드

public AddObjectPermission ( IPermission permission ) : void
permission IPermission
리턴 void

AddObjectPermissions() 공개 메소드

public AddObjectPermissions ( IEnumerable e ) : void
e IEnumerable
리턴 void

AddRole() 공개 메소드

public AddRole ( string role ) : void
role string
리턴 void

AddRoles() 공개 메소드

public AddRoles ( IEnumerable roles ) : void
roles IEnumerable
리턴 void

AddStringPermission() 공개 메소드

public AddStringPermission ( string permission ) : void
permission string
리턴 void

AddStringPermissions() 공개 메소드

public AddStringPermissions ( IEnumerable e ) : void
e IEnumerable
리턴 void

Equals() 공개 메소드

public Equals ( object obj ) : bool
obj object
리턴 bool

GetHashCode() 공개 메소드

public GetHashCode ( ) : int
리턴 int

Merge() 공개 메소드

public Merge ( IAuthenticationInfo other ) : void
other IAuthenticationInfo
리턴 void

SimpleAccount() 공개 메소드

public SimpleAccount ( ) : System
리턴 System

SimpleAccount() 공개 메소드

public SimpleAccount ( ICollection principals, object credentials, string realmName, ISet roles = null, ISet permissions = null ) : System
principals ICollection
credentials object
realmName string
roles ISet
permissions ISet
리턴 System

SimpleAccount() 공개 메소드

public SimpleAccount ( IPrincipalCollection principals, object credentials, ISet roles = null, ISet permissions = null ) : System
principals IPrincipalCollection
credentials object
roles ISet
permissions ISet
리턴 System

SimpleAccount() 공개 메소드

public SimpleAccount ( object principal, object credentials, string realmName, ISet roles = null, ISet permissions = null ) : System
principal object
credentials object
realmName string
roles ISet
permissions ISet
리턴 System

ToString() 공개 메소드

public ToString ( ) : string
리턴 string